01.What is a solar water pump, and how does it work?

A solar water pump uses energy from the sun, captured through solar panels, to power a pump that moves water from a source (like a well, borehole, or river) to where it’s needed. The solar panels generate electricity which powers the pump, making it an efficient, renewable energy solution for water pumping without relying on grid power or fuel.

05.How long does a solar water pump last, and what maintenance is required?

A well-maintained solar water pump system can last up to 20 years or more. Maintenance generally involves periodic cleaning of solar panels to ensure they’re not blocked by dirt or debris and checking the pump and system for any wear and tear. Regular inspections and minor adjustments can keep the system running smoothly for many years.

Drip irrigation is a highly efficient method of watering plants directly at the roots using a network of pipes, tubes, and emitters. When paired with solar water pumps, it offers an eco-friendly solution for delivering consistent, controlled water to crops. Solar-powered pumps can efficiently supply the water needed for drip irrigation systems, optimizing water use while saving energy and costs.

01. Can solar water pumps power both drip irrigation and sprinkler systems?

Yes, solar water pumps can be used to power both drip irrigation and sprinkler systems. The choice of system depends on the water requirements, crop type, and landscape. Solar pumps can be scaled to meet the demands of both low-volume drip irrigation and higher-volume sprinkler systems, providing versatility in agricultural applications.
